Loyola University Chicago has a 81.4% acceptance rate. Loyola University Chicago is a private nonprofit 4-year institution in Chicago, IL, with a median SAT of 1260 and a median ACT of 29. The average net price is $36,079 per year after financial aid, and it is accredited by Higher Learning Commission.

SAT & ACT Scores at Loyola University Chicago

Middle-50% test scores of admitted students at Loyola University Chicago (25th to 75th percentile), per federal IPEDS data:

Test25th percentileMedian75th percentile
SAT (total, 400–1600)116012601360
ACT (composite, 1–36)272931

Net Price by Family Income

What students actually pay after grants and scholarships at Loyola University Chicago:

Family IncomeAvg Net Price/Year
$0 – $30,000$28,992
$30,001 – $48,000$28,663
$48,001 – $75,000$32,432
$75,001 – $110,000$36,853
$110,000+$42,346
